I am trying to set up dbpedia-spotlight for the Dutch language. There are some
datasets available for Dutch (nl),
but I expect to at least need the dbpedia "disambiguation" dataset, which is
not available for download.
After setting up extraction_framework for "nl" and doing :
editing extraction.properties: reoving all extractors.** except:
extractors.nl<http://extractors.nl/>=MappingExtractor,org.dbpedia.extraction.mappings.DisambiguationExtractor,HomepageExtractor,ImageExtractor,\
InterLanguageLinksExtractor)
$ cd dump;mvn scala:run
I get an error message:
..
INFO: Mappings loaded (nl)
java.lang.reflect.InvocationTargetException
..
Caused by: java.util.NoSuchElementException: key not found: nl
at scala.collection.MapLike$class.default(MapLike.scala:225)
at scala.collection.immutable.HashMap.default(HashMap.scala:38)
at scala.collection.MapLike$class.apply(MapLike.scala:135)
at scala.collection.immutable.HashMap.apply(HashMap.scala:38)
at
org.dbpedia.extraction.mappings.DisambiguationExtractor.<init>(DisambiguationExtractor.scala:22)
I assume this means that some classes have not been implemented for "nl"?
If so, I would like to know if such an effort is on the way or whether it would
be feasible for me to give it a try?
Is there some pointer/documentation on how to get started?

DETAILS OF WHAT I DID
I managed to install the extraction_framework. The documentation seems a bit
out of date though so it could be I
did things wrong.
I managed to download the "nl" wikipedia input by editing dump.properties and
doing
$ cd dump; mvn scala:run -Dlauncher=download
Extraction started when commenting out all
other "extraction.**=" entries in dump/extraction.properties leaving only
extractors.nl<http://extractors.nl/>=MappingExtractor
and running
$ mvn scala:run
The output indicates that extraction proceeds nicely.
But I expect that in the result the "disambiguation" result will be missing.
When I replace extractors.nl<http://extractors.nl/> (analoguous to other
languages):
extractors.nl<http://extractors.nl/>=MappingExtractor,org.dbpedia.extraction.mappings.DisambiguationExtractor,HomepageExtractor,ImageExtractor,\
InterLanguageLinksExtractor
I get error messages mentioned above.
